What does a network engineer in gaming do?

A Network Engineer in gaming is responsible for designing, implementing, and maintaining the network infrastructure that supports online games. They work to ensure low latency, high reliability, and security for multiplayer gaming experiences. Their tasks include optimizing server performance, managing traffic loads, troubleshooting connectivity issues, and collaborating with developers to support new game features. By ensuring seamless connectivity, they play a crucial role in delivering a smooth and enjoyable gaming experience for players.

How do network engineers in the gaming industry collaborate with game developers and QA teams to ensure optimal multiplayer performance?

Network Engineers in the gaming sector work closely with game developers and QA teams to design, implement, and troubleshoot network architectures that support smooth multiplayer experiences. They regularly participate in cross-functional meetings to discuss network requirements, latency concerns, and real-time data flow. Collaboration often involves analyzing logs, running stress tests, and refining protocols to minimize lag and packet loss. This teamwork ensures that the network infrastructure aligns with gameplay needs and provides a seamless experience for players.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a network engineer in the gaming industry?

To thrive as a Network Engineer in gaming, you need a solid understanding of networking protocols, troubleshooting, and infrastructure, usually backed by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with tools like Wireshark, network simulators, cloud platforms, and certifications such as CCNA or AWS Certified Solutions Architect is common.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ication help in coordinating with developers and resolving latency or connectivity issues. These skills are crucial for maintaining stable, low-latency gaming environments and delivering a seamless experience to players.

What is the difference between Network Engineer Gaming vs Network Engineer IT?

AspectNetwork Engineer GamingNetwork Engineer IT
CertificationsCCNA, CompTIA Network+CCNA, CompTIA Network+
Work EnvironmentGaming companies, esports venues, game development studiosCorporate offices, data centers, enterprise networks
Industry UsageVideo game industry, esports, gaming hardwareBusiness, finance, healthcare, general enterprise
Job FocusOptimizing gaming network performance, low latency for online gamingMaintaining reliable enterprise network infrastructure

While both roles require similar networking certifications and skills, Network Engineer Gaming specializes in gaming environments, focusing on low latency and high-performance networks for online gaming and esports. In contrast, Network Engineer IT covers broader enterprise networks across various industries. The choice depends on your interest in gaming technology versus general IT infrastructure.

The Role:

The VDC Engineer works with and supports the project team to provide a variety of VDC services. This role is suitable for individuals with a technical background and an understanding of building systems and construction. At TW Constructors, the VDC Engineer will focus on model management, BIM coordination, collaboration, clash detection resolution, and quality assurance. For this role, this individual will be supporting a variety of mission critical, healthcare and specialized facility projects throughout the region, and report to the VDC Manager.



Responsibilities:


  • Lead project BIM coordination efforts
  • Manage sub-contract trade partner BIM personnel
  • Build and maintain federated 3D models
  • Conduct clash detection tests and determine constructability issues between various trade disciplines
  • Assign and manage model constructability/clash issues
  • Establish and enforce BIM Standards, protocols, and workflows for project BIM coordination
  • Conduct quality control checks to ensure models adhere to project standards
  • Regularly communicate BIM progress, standards, and process with project stakeholders
  • Assist VDC Manager in establishing, maintaining, or improving internal BIM standards
  • Other responsibilities may include: authoring drawings, creating 3D/4D visualizations, providing internal technical support and training
  • Review construction documents to ensure adherence to developed and established specifications and standards.
  • Help to identify constructability issues, opportunities for system streamlining and propose solutions and implementation.
